Bits of movable DNA called transposable elements or TEs fill up the genomes of plants and animals, but it has remained unclear how a genome can survive a rapid burst of hundreds, even thousands of new TE insertions. Now, for the first time, research by plant biologists have documented the impact of such a burst in a rice strain that is accumulating more than 40 new TE insertions per plant per generation of an element called mPing.
